реклама на сайте
подробности

 
 
 
Reply to this topicStart new topic
> BIDIRECTIONAL pin в Quartus 7.1, Found logic contention
Evgeniiy
сообщение Apr 21 2009, 13:11
Сообщение #1


Частый гость
**

Группа: Участник
Сообщений: 84
Регистрация: 5-03-09
Из: СПБ
Пользователь №: 45 705



Здравствуйте!
При использовании вывода bidir в (графическом редакторе!!!) возникает worning "Found logic contention" и на выходе неопределенное состояние, при написании на vhdl такой проблемы нет, если создать блок и вставить его в графический редактор- не работает. В Quartus 5.0 этот же проект работает нормально.

Текст VHDL:

entity bd is
port( Input: in std_logic_vector (3 downto 0);
WR: in std_logic;

Q: inout std_logic_vector (3 downto 0)
);
end bd;



architecture behv of bd is
Begin

Process(Input)
begin

if WR = '1' then
Q <= Input;
else Q <= "ZZZZ";
end if;
End process;
end behv;

В графическом редакторе собираю схему приведенную на сайте altera в качестве примера---- http://www.altera.com/support/examples/ged...mp;WT.oss=bidir ----- и тоже выдает Found logic contention.

Возможно в 7-й версии нужны какие то особые настройки для использования bidir?????


help.gif help.gif help.gif
Go to the top of the page
 
+Quote Post
sazh
сообщение Apr 21 2009, 13:40
Сообщение #2


Гуру
******

Группа: Свой
Сообщений: 2 435
Регистрация: 6-10-04
Из: Петербург
Пользователь №: 804



Цитата(Evgeniiy @ Apr 21 2009, 17:11) *
Q: inout std_logic_vector (3 downto 0)
);

Возможно в 7-й версии нужны какие то особые настройки для использования bidir?????


help.gif help.gif help.gif


А с чего это он здесь bidir. при таком использовании он только out.
Да и список чувствительности неполный. Process(Input, WR)
Go to the top of the page
 
+Quote Post
Evgeniiy
сообщение Apr 21 2009, 15:19
Сообщение #3


Частый гость
**

Группа: Участник
Сообщений: 84
Регистрация: 5-03-09
Из: СПБ
Пользователь №: 45 705



Я не привел вторую часть где он вход, но это и не важно, если создать блок и вставить его в графический редактор, то и эта весч не работает.
А список чувствительности при синтезе игнорируется и его полнота не может влиять на проект
Go to the top of the page
 
+Quote Post
Kuzmi4
сообщение Apr 21 2009, 15:28
Сообщение #4


Гуру
******

Группа: Свой
Сообщений: 3 304
Регистрация: 13-02-07
Из: 55°55′5″ 37°52′16″
Пользователь №: 25 329



Цитата
писок чувствительности при синтезе игнорируется и его полнота не может влиять на проект

Блин.. не знал.... почему то был уверен в обратном..... biggrin.gif
Go to the top of the page
 
+Quote Post
Sefo
сообщение Apr 21 2009, 17:05
Сообщение #5


Местный
***

Группа: Свой
Сообщений: 429
Регистрация: 11-08-05
Из: Санкт-Петербург
Пользователь №: 7 537



Цитата(Kuzmi4 @ Apr 21 2009, 19:28) *
Блин.. не знал.... почему то был уверен в обратном..... biggrin.gif


Список чувствительности на симуляцию влияет, а вот синтезаторам на него наплевать.

Цитата(Evgeniiy @ Apr 21 2009, 17:11) *
help.gif help.gif help.gif


Выложили бы проект, что ли... На Алтеровскую схему никаких левых сообщений 8-ка не выдает.
Go to the top of the page
 
+Quote Post
Evgeniiy
сообщение Apr 21 2009, 17:44
Сообщение #6


Частый гость
**

Группа: Участник
Сообщений: 84
Регистрация: 5-03-09
Из: СПБ
Пользователь №: 45 705



тоесть 8-ка не выдает Found logic contention? и симуляция проходит нормально??


у меня не работает даже альтеровская, проект тут не причем. при симуляции неопределенное состояние
Go to the top of the page
 
+Quote Post
sazh
сообщение Apr 21 2009, 17:58
Сообщение #7


Гуру
******

Группа: Свой
Сообщений: 2 435
Регистрация: 6-10-04
Из: Петербург
Пользователь №: 804



Цитата(Evgeniiy @ Apr 21 2009, 21:44) *
тоесть 8-ка не выдает Found logic contention? и симуляция проходит нормально??


у меня не работает даже альтеровская, проект тут не причем. при симуляции неопределенное состояние


Качайте сразу 9 версию. Для большей надежности.
Go to the top of the page
 
+Quote Post
Evgeniiy
сообщение Apr 21 2009, 18:25
Сообщение #8


Частый гость
**

Группа: Участник
Сообщений: 84
Регистрация: 5-03-09
Из: СПБ
Пользователь №: 45 705



завтра на работе попробую 8ю

но что ж такое, это у меня версия паленая что ли
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 18th July 2025 - 06:41
Рейтинг@Mail.ru


Страница сгенерированна за 0.01416 секунд с 7
ELECTRONIX ©2004-2016